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: A collection of recipes, party tips, quotes and anecdotes from wildly entertaining women like Dorothy Parker, Dolly Parton and many more. Get ready to party like it’s 1929 with Zelda Fitzgerald, drink cosmos like Sarah Jessica Parker, and have a picnic à la Mary Pickford. From Dollywood to Hollywood, these dazzling dames know how to throw a party that gets people talking. Part how-to guide, part history, and completely hilarious, Wild Women Throw a Party includes 110 original recipes inspired by the stories of our favorite famous feminists. Who knew dangerous debutante Peggy Guggenheim, famous for her arty salons, was also a gifted gourmet? Or that when Eleanor Roosevelt wasn’t serving at soup kitchens, she was hosting the most elegant “do’s” around. Wild Women Throw a Party explores women’s history, food trivia, and party planning ideas while asking, What is feminism? Who is a feminist? And where exactly do we find a woman’s place?

Book excerpt: In this book, Tracy Pintchman has assembled ten leading scholars of Hinduism to explore the complex relationship between Hindu women's rituals and their lives beyond ritual. The book focuses particularly on the relationship of women's ritual practices to domesticity, exposing and exploring the nuances, complexities, and limits of this relationship. In many cultural and historical contexts, including contemporary India, women's everyday lives tend to revolve heavily around domestic and interpersonal concerns, especially care for children, the home, husbands, and other relatives. Hence, women's religiosity also tends to emphasize the domestic realm and the relationships most central to women. But women's religious concerns certainly extend beyond domesticity. Furthermore, even the domestic religious activities that Hindu women perform may not merely replicate or affirm traditionally formulated domestic ideals but may function strategically to reconfigure, reinterpret, criticize, or even reject such ideals. This volume takes a fresh look at issues of the relationship between Hindu women's ritual practices and normative domesticity. In so doing, it emphasizes female innovation and agency in constituting and transforming both ritual and the domestic realm and calls attention to the limitations of normative domesticity as a category relevant to many forms of Hindu women's religious practice.

Book excerpt: From the creators of Chocolate Bar, New York City's candy store for grown-ups, comes Chocolate Bar—a delicious ode to the sweet that entrances so many, with more than 30 recipes from such stellar chocolatiers as Jacques Torres and Andrew Shotts. These range from classic cookies, brownies, and retro desserts to such renegade treats as White Chocolate Lemon Cream, Spiced Meatballs. . . even a chocolate body scrub! Co-founders Lewis and Nelson espouse a stylish philosophy of fun and enjoyment, with the focus on baking, drinking, dining, and entertaining with chocolate. They also explain how to “educate” one's chocolate palate by exploring products with various cacao percentages, origins, textures, aromas, and tastes. Readers will learn how to throw a chocolate tasting party, a swank chocolate martini soiree, a ski lodge get-together complete with chocolate fondue and hot toddies, or a celebration of childhood choco-centric memories, with the emphasis on sundaes, fudges, ice creams, and other nostalgic indulgences. Using Chocolate Bar's own unique entertaining and party ideas, they explain why chocolate is appropriate—indeed, necessary—for breakfast, lunch, or dinner.
